Output 89a8318258ad49453f3defb848651016c01375a0a21cf4945834a2525c9d0a9c:34

value
1562
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bbe743cdb0a8b51f53649ab23ff5e94cf657a36da108aee64692d6cc78c93991
address
bc1ph0n58nds4z6375myn2erla0ffnm90gmd5yy2aejxjttvc7xf8xgsukzulc
transaction
89a8318258ad49453f3defb848651016c01375a0a21cf4945834a2525c9d0a9c
spent
true